Stern Pinball hires new chief revenue officer

MELROSE PARK — Stern Pinball Inc., the world’s leading maker of real pinball games, hired former Topps Trading Cards Vice President John Buscaglia as the new Chief Revenue Officer.

Buscaglia joins the Stern Pinball team as they continue to grow pinball sales and enthusiasm around the world.

“John is a perfect addition to our company. His experience with consumer sales and collectibles will help us reach our goal of creating a whole new generation of pinball players,” said Gary Stern, founder, CEO and chairman of Stern Pinball.

Buscaglia joins the Stern Pinball family tradition of producing quality pinball games. The company traces its lineage to Philadelphia in the 1930s when Sam Stern entered the business of operating pinball games. Sam Stern subsequently partnered with Harry Williams to build the Williams Manufacturing Company and passed his lifelong enthusiasm for the game and the business of pinball to his son Gary. Today pinball remains one of the world’s favorite games.
